Windows OS not Directing to 'Advanced Boot Options' Start up Settings after BSOD

 ISSUE:

When a windows Machine/Server is not directly get into 'Advance Start Up Settings' after BSOD or continuously rebooting after BSOD. But you can go to Recovery Mode or Command Prompt. Even when you press F8 it will continue to BSOD.

Then only Option you have are :

Launch Startup Repair -> You can go to Command Prompt 

Start Windows Normally - BSOD even you press F8


This will not show you:


SOLUTION:

Since you can go to 'Command Prompt' When you select Option Launch Startup Repair you can type this commands then reboot it.

bcdedit /set {globalsettings} advancedoptions true

 then reboot it. After the reboot you can now go to Advanced Boot Options and you can Select 'Last Known Good Configuration. This will stopped the BSOD and this one works for me.

To disable startup to not go to Advance Boot Option you need to run this command.

bcdedit /set {globalsettings} advancedoptions false
